Foundations of Video Game AI: Reinforcement Learning and GAIL

Learn to train intelligent game characters using reinforcement learning, neural networks, and generative adversarial imitation learning through structured written guides.

⏱ 1 ساعة 9 دقيقة 📚 11 درس

حول هذه الدورة

Creating realistic and adaptive video game behaviors requires moving beyond rigid, hand-coded scripts. Modern game development leverages generative AI and machine learning to build characters that learn dynamically from their environments and human players. In this text-focused course, you will transition from basic theory to understanding the mechanics of advanced agent training. You will gain a clear conceptual grasp of how to design agent policies, configure reward structures, and use imitation learning to replicate complex human play styles. What you will learn: Understand key terminology of reinforcement learning, agent-environment loops, and Markov decision processes; Configure neural network architectures to represent game character policies; Apply Generative Adversarial Imitation Learning (GAIL) to train agents directly from demonstration data; Implement core training concepts using modern Python libraries like Gymnasium and PyTorch; Analyze agent performance and tune hyperparameters to stabilize learning. The course begins with foundational definitions of AI agents before transitioning to step-by-step code walkthroughs. You will progress through practical explanations of reinforcement learning and imitation techniques, concluding with strategies for debugging agent behavior. This course is designed for aspiring game developers and programmers who are new to machine learning, requiring only a basic understanding of Python. Start reading today to build smarter, more responsive video game characters.

ما الذي ستحصل عليه

  • 📜 شهادة إتمام
    أضفها إلى ملفك على LinkedIn
  • 💬 Personal AI tutor
    Stuck on a lesson? Ask your built-in tutor anything, any time.
  • ♾️ وصول مدى الحياة
    عُد متى شئت، بلا انتهاء
  • 📱 الهاتف أو الكمبيوتر
    يعمل في أي مكان وعلى أي جهاز
  • 💸 استرداد خلال 30 يومًا
    دون أسئلة
  • قصير ومركَّز
    1 ساعة 9 دقيقة من المحتوى التطبيقي

المراجعات

لا توجد مراجعات بعد — كن أول من يشارك تجربته.

اكتب مراجعة

سنطلب منك تسجيل الدخول بعد الإرسال — تُحفظ مسودتك.

المتعلمون أخذوا أيضًا

الأسئلة الشائعة

ما الذي أحتاجه لأخذ هذه الدورة؟ +

يكفي هاتف أو كمبيوتر متصل بالإنترنت. بدون تثبيتات أو أجهزة خاصة.

كيف يمكنني الدفع؟ +

بالبطاقة عبر Stripe أو بالعملات الرقمية. لا نخزن بيانات البطاقة — يتولى Stripe ذلك بأمان.

هل يمكنني استرداد المال؟ +

نعم — استرداد كامل خلال 30 يومًا، دون أسئلة.

إلى متى يستمر وصولي؟ +

إلى الأبد. بمجرد الشراء، الدورة لك تعود إليها متى شئت.

هل سأحصل على شهادة؟ +

نعم. عند الإتمام ستحصل على شهادة يمكنك إضافتها إلى ملفك في LinkedIn.

مصمَّم للعاملين في
التقنية التصميم المالية التسويق الرعاية الصحية التعليم الضيافة التصنيع